Verilog与QuartusII构建:实用EDA课程设计——多功能数字钟
版权申诉
![](https://csdnimg.cn/release/wenkucmsfe/public/img/starY.0159711c.png)
在"EDA课程设计多功能数字钟.pdf"文档中,主要探讨了电子设计自动化(EDA)技术在现代电子工程设计中的应用,特别是使用Verilog语言和Altera公司的Quartus II开发工具进行课程设计。该课程设计旨在让学生深入了解并实践EDA技术,将理论知识与实际项目相结合。
首先,文档介绍了EDA的基本概念,它是一种以计算机为基础的电子产品自动化设计技术,通过硬件描述语言(HDL,如Verilog)和原理图描述,实现了从设计概念到可编程逻辑器件(PLD)或复杂可编程逻辑集成电路(CPLD/FPGA)的高效设计过程。Quartus II作为第四代开发系统,简化了设计者对器件内部复杂性的依赖,允许他们使用熟悉的工具创建设计,然后由工具自动转换为所需的格式。
设计的核心任务是设计一个多功能数字钟,包括实时显示时、分、秒,并具备计时、闹钟和校时功能,以整点报时的形式提醒用户。这种设计体现了Verilog语言的优势,如良好的可读性、可移植性和易理解性,使得自顶向下设计方法得以有效应用。
课程设计分为多个章节,如第一章介绍了Quartus II仿真软件的使用,尽管章节标题缺失,但可以推测这部分内容会涵盖如何使用该软件进行设计验证和调试。第二章至第四章则详述了具体的设计步骤和策略,包括顶层模块的调用、设计原则、目标设定、方法选择以及各个模块的详细设计,如CLOCK模块的实现。
通过这个课程设计,学生们不仅可以掌握Verilog语言的运用,还能体验到从概念设计到实际硬件的完整流程,这对于电子科学及技术专业的学生来说,是一次宝贵的实践锻炼,有助于提升他们的系统设计能力和电子工程实践技能。同时,这个项目的实用性也让学生认识到电子技术在日常生活中的广泛应用。
2022-11-01 上传
1248 浏览量
2023-05-19 上传
234 浏览量
151 浏览量
2022-07-01 上传
2022-06-20 上传
106 浏览量
![](https://profile-avatar.csdnimg.cn/685a9662e294460aabe14011440192a4_m0_71272694.jpg!1)
不吃鸳鸯锅
- 粉丝: 8574
最新资源
- RealView编译工具编译器用户指南:3.1版详细文档
- 微软CryptoAPI标准接口函数详解
- SWT/JFace实战指南:设计Eclipse 3.0图形应用
- Eclipse常用快捷键全览:编辑、查看与导航操作指南
- MyEclipse 6 Java EE开发入门指南
- C语言实现PID算法详解与参数调优
- Java SDK详解:从安装到实战
- C语言标准与实现详解:从基础到实践
- 单片机与红外编码技术:精确探测障碍物方案
- Oracle SQL优化技巧:选择优化器与索引策略
- FastReport 3.0 编程手册:组件、报表设计和操作指南
- 掌握Struts框架:MVC设计模式在Java Web开发中的基石
- Java持久性API实战:从入门到显示数据库数据
- 高可用技术详解:LanderVault集群模块白皮书
- Paypal集成教程:Advanced Integration Method详解
- 车载导航地图数据的空间组织结构分析